This Career Advancement Programme in Security Risk Assessment for Travel Industry Professionals equips participants with the critical skills needed to identify, analyze, and mitigate security risks within the travel sector. The programme focuses on practical application, ensuring graduates are immediately employable.
Learning outcomes include mastering threat intelligence analysis, developing comprehensive risk assessment methodologies, implementing effective security protocols, and effectively communicating risk to stakeholders. Participants will gain proficiency in relevant international security standards and best practices, critical for today's travel industry.
The programme's duration is flexible, typically spanning 12 weeks of intensive, part-time study, designed to accommodate working professionals. This allows for a seamless integration of learning with existing commitments. Online modules and in-person workshops offer a blended learning experience.
The travel industry faces evolving security challenges, making this programme highly relevant. Graduates will be equipped to contribute meaningfully to enhancing the safety and security of travellers, transportation, and tourism infrastructure. Expertise in crisis management and business continuity planning are key components, enhancing career prospects within the field of travel security.
This Security Risk Assessment training is tailored to address the specific needs of the travel industry, covering areas such as aviation security, maritime security, and hotel security, alongside broader risk management principles.
